The charity supports children and young people, elderly people, and the general public. Barsham Village Hall is a registered charity whose purpose is recreation. It delivers its work by providing buildings, facilities, or open space. The charity is based in Beccles and operates in Norfolk and Suffolk.

Activities & Mission

We provide a community hub for self-help groups like the AA, and other organisations such as the WI, PC and PCC. We are the local polling station, and have regular hirers: a dog training school, a model railways group, circuit training, band rehearsals, and special events like weddings, birthdays and parties. We charge £6 an hour for locals & regular hirers, and negotiate rates for others.
